Subject: FareForge cut-over complete

Hi — quick summary since you're picking this up next week. We finished the cut-over from the legacy shipping-fee scripts to FareForge, our new rules engine, on Tuesday night. All zones now evaluate through the engine; the old path is disabled but kept for thirty days as a fallback. Rule changes go through the staging evaluator and require sign-off from the logistics lead. Latency is stable at roughly 12ms per evaluation. For reference, the engine currently runs with these configuration values.

settings of fafog-haduf:
ZORIX_PIN=4648
ZORIX_METRICS_HOST=metrics.zorix.paliqsys.corp
ZORIX_LOG_LEVEL=info
ZORIX_TENANT=druix

**09:41** — Noticed the Fakewright test-data factory was churning out users with identical timestamps, which quietly broke every ordering test in the Pellgrove suite. Turns out the seeded clock helper stopped advancing after last week's refactor. Pinned the factory back one version and reruns went green. If you're on call and see this again, check whether you're running the following build.

trace token, tawep-fahif: htk3_b58

Handover — Inventory Write-Down

To the incoming director: the Q3 write-down on Caldmere freezer stock is booked. Roughly 40% of the Pellerin line was obsolete after the recipe change. Auditors at Strath & Voss signed off. Remaining stock moves to the Dunbright outlet channel next month. Watch the Orvan warehouse counts; variance there triggered this. The confidential planning note on next steps follows directly below.

board note of kageg-bahof: The renewal with Holwynax Holdings closes at $2 million a year, 5 percent below the last contract. Project Ulaath slips by two quarters because of the supplier delay.

For the incoming director. Launch window: week 14. Channel: direct plus the Ralsten partner network. Pricing locked at tier review; no discounting in the first sixty days. Manufacturing at the Oakenfeld site is ramped to 40k units; second shift approved if preorders exceed forecast. Marketing assets clear legal by week 11. Risks: firmware certification lag and a single-source display panel. Mitigations owned by the program office. Review the gate checklist before your first steering meeting. Strategic context follows directly below.

internal memo for hahaf-kahof: Only 39 of the 428 pilot accounts renewed Sorion, so a churn review is set for April 12. Praokix Freight is in early talks to buy Queniusox Group for about $145.8 million.